WebOn average anglers can expect to pay around $900 dollars for a private 4-hour trip while chasing Mahi Mahi. Full day charters typically cost between $1200 to $1500 for 7 or 8 hours. Most private charter boats will hold 1-6 anglers making the average cost per person $150 for a half-day and around $250 for a full day.

WebThere are several main indicators for whether or not birds are chasing dolphin. The first indicator for finding productive birds is speed. Dolphin never migrate more than about 6 knots unless they are aggressively chasing flying fish. If you see birds flying at 20 miles an hour, don't bother chasing them.

WebWhen trolling, fishermen should use 30 to 50 pound class rods and reels. Rigs should include a 7/0 to 9/0 hook for ballyhoo, when setting out their offerings.
